Guava chutney or Amrood Chutney is a conventional Indian recipe, which is cooked in different ways across different cities in the country.
With many variations existing as a part of regional cuisine. Guava Chutney is made with fresh Guava (Amrood),ginger, some dry nuts and simple spices.
